在现代科技领域,尤其是工程测量、数据处理与分析中,如何确保数据的准确性与可靠性是至关重要的。测量平差作为一种有效的数据处理技术,通过最小化误差的影响,提高数据质量,已成为高效程序设计中的关键工具。本文旨在探讨基于测量平差的高效程序设计方法,阐述其原理、应用及优化策略。
#### 1. 测量平差的基本原理
测量平差的核心在于利用数学模型和统计理论,对观测数据进行调整,以减小误差的影响,达到最佳估计的目的。这一过程通常包括数据预处理(如滤波、去噪)、模型建立(根据实际问题选择合适的数学模型)、参数估计(通过最小二乘法或其他优化算法求解)以及结果评估(计算残差、评估精度)等步骤。
沃九信成有限公司#### 2. 高效程序设计的重要性
在实际应用中,高效的程序设计能够显著提升数据处理的速度和精度, 河南恒迈电子科技有限公司减少资源消耗, 巴易达有限公司尤其是在大规模数据集处理、实时应用或高精度要求场景下尤为重要。这不仅要求算法的优化,合肥市惠诺贸易有限公司还涉及编程语言的选择、数据结构的设计、并行计算策略的采用等多个层面。
#### 3. 基于测量平差的高效程序设计策略
- **算法优化**:选择适合测量平差问题的高效算法,如改进的最小二乘法、快速傅里叶变换等,减少计算复杂度。
- **数据结构设计**:合理设计数据存储和访问方式,最好的礼物利用现代编程语言的特性(如C++的STL库、Python的NumPy数组)提高数据处理效率。
- **并行计算**:充分利用多核处理器或分布式计算环境,将计算任务分解并行执行,加速数据处理过程。
- **动态优化**:在程序运行过程中,根据数据特性动态调整算法参数,以适应不同情况下的最优性能。
- **错误检测与容错机制**:实现对异常数据的快速识别和排除,确保程序稳定运行,即使在数据质量问题较高的情况下也能保持较高的输出质量。
#### 4. 应用实例与案例研究
在卫星定位系统、机器人导航、结构健康监测等领域,基于测量平差的高效程序设计已被广泛应用,通过精确的数据处理和分析,实现了高精度的位置定位、路径规划和状态监控,显著提高了系统的可靠性和效率。
综上所述,基于测量平差的高效程序设计方法不仅能够有效提升数据处理的质量和速度,还能在多个领域带来技术创新和应用突破。随着计算机技术的不断进步最好的礼物,这一领域的研究和发展前景广阔,未来有望在更多复杂应用场景中发挥重要作用。